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
56563932 303841648 06273316400
17667675 7634
17667675 7634
3293562 1159596 50722623 15
All about undefined
Interested in learning more?
17667675 7634
3293562 1159596 50722623 15
See more
8895078630 77 9654709
67372348 134087 3762277
See more
2091739736 64190319236 10
526 4130 0563168686 623403
See more